What are practical small bathroom with bathtub ideas that actually work?

Start by treating the bathtub as the focal point and choosing the right size for your space. For space-saving, opt for a compact alcove tub or a small freestanding tub that fits your measurements. Use a wall-mounted faucet to free up deck space and pair with a slim vanity or recessed storage to keep the floor clear. For a vintage-inspired look, choose a clawfoot or slipper tub in a small footprint and finish with beadboard panels, hex or penny tile, and brass fittings. Lighter colors and glossy surfaces will make the room feel larger, and a tall mirror or two can bounce light around. If possible, use a glass panel instead of a heavy shower curtain to preserve openness, and consider a pocket door to reclaim hallway space. How can I maximize bathtub space in a small bathroom without sacrificing style?

Maximize bathtub space by choosing a layout that keeps the tub accessible while freeing floor area. Pick a tub that fits snugly in a corner or alcove and add a glass panel instead of a bulky curtain to maintain openness. Use vertical storage like a slim wall cabinet or recessed niches around the tub for toiletries. For the vintage vibe, select retro-style brass or aged-nickel fixtures and subway or hex tile, paired with a pale color palette to keep the room airy. Finish with a slim, wall-mounted vanity and abundant lighting to create the illusion of more space.

Which bathroom decor tips help a small bathroom look bigger while keeping a vintage vibe?

To make a small bathroom feel bigger while delivering a vintage feel, lean on light colors, lots of white, and reflective surfaces like large mirrors and glossy tiles. Use vertical patterns and a minimal footprint to draw the eye upward and create space illusions. Add mood with layered lighting (ambient, task, and accent) and vintage hardware in brass or bronze. Use smart storage such as recessed niches, built-in shelving, or a floating vanity to avoid crowding the floor. Finally, incorporate vintage touches (beadboard, patterned floor tile, or retro accessories) to keep the look cohesive without overwhelming the room.

Are there affordable compact bathroom ideas that still give a vintage-inspired look with a bathtub?

Yes—there are affordable compact bathroom ideas that still give a vintage-inspired look with a bathtub. Start with space-saving basics: a compact or corner tub, and a slim, wall-mounted vanity to maximize floor space. Use budget-friendly vintage cues like peel-and-stick hex or penny tile, beadboard wallpaper or panels, and affordable brass or brass-tone hardware. Consider repainting or refinishing existing fixtures instead of full replacements, and source second-hand pieces that fit the vibe. Small DIY projects—installing a tile accent wall, updating hardware, or adding a beadboard niche—can go a long way without breaking the bank.
